At a glance

Fortress Balance Sheet Strategy Delivers Margin Expansion: Seacoast Banking Corporation of Florida is executing a deliberate strategy of combining opportunistic M&A with organic talent acquisition to build a defensible, low-cost deposit franchise, driving a 34 basis point net interest margin expansion to 3.58% in 2025 while maintaining superior credit quality (NPAs down 23% to 0.37% of assets).

Villages Acquisition Transforms Scale and Earnings Power: The October 2025 acquisition of Villages Bancorporation added $4 billion in assets and 19 branches in North Central Florida, closing with materially higher tangible equity than projected, which enabled a January 2026 securities repositioning that will boost future earnings by 290 basis points without tangible book value dilution.

2026 Guidance Implies Significant Earnings Inflection: Management's outlook for 29-31% revenue growth, 53-55% efficiency ratio, and $2.48-2.52 EPS reflects confidence that integration benefits and a 15% expansion in banker headcount will drive high-single-digit loan growth, though execution risk on the July 2026 technology conversion remains critical.
